Nico & Lola:
Kindness Shared Between a Boy and a Dog
By Meggan Hill
Photographs by Susan M. Graunke
Genuine Prints LLC
www.nicoandlola.com
Available May 2009
ISBN: 978-0-615-23040-5
$16.95 Hardcover
Children’s Picture Book / Ages 2-11 / Children and pets
Author, photographer, and Nico and Lola live in northern Illinois
How will I be so kind? Young Nico must search his heart to find ways to be so kind when he takes care of his canine friend Lola. A book for every child to read, share, and remember!
“It’s not often a book comes along that has such a delightful presentation. Nico & Lola, by Meggan Hill, does a wonderful job expressing the meaning of kindness. Young children will easily identify with Nico and will be drawn to the great photographs.”
– Sharon, Beaverdale Books, Des Moines, IA

Julia Gillian (And the Quest for Joy)
By Alison McGhee
Illustrated by Drazen Kozjan
Scholastic Press
www.scholastic.com
On sale April 15, 2009
ISBN-13: 978-0545033503
$16.99 Hardcover
Children’s Middle Grade Fiction / Ages 9-12 /
Second book in Julia Gillian series / set in Minneapolis
kids, friends, and elementary school experiences
And now available in paperback for Spring 2009!
Julia Gillian (and the Art of Knowing)
Scholastic Paperbacks
On sale April 15, 2009
ISBN-13: 978-0545033497
$6.99 Trade Paperback
Irresistible heroine Julia Gillian is back again for a second adventure in the complex world of elementary school.
“McGhee’s story will ring true true to young readers dealing with their own fears.”
– Pittsburgh Post-Gazette on Julia Gillian (and the Art of Knowing)
